Analysing policy success and failure in Australia: Pink batts and set‐top boxes
Abstract This article examines two Australian government programs from the Rudd/Gillard Labor government, the Home Insulation Program (HIP) and the Digital Switchover Household Assistance Scheme (HAS). Both became shibboleths of the Labor government's perceived waste and incompetence.

Games and gamification projects in the Australian public sector
Abstract This article surveys the arrival of gameful government into Australian public sector practice. Gameful government is a shorthand, descriptive term denoting the interpenetration of (video)games, and design elements and thinking from them, into public sector work.

Hexagon Fraud Theory Analysis on Financial Statement Fraud
The purpose of this study is to investigate the effect of Hexagon Fraud Theory (financial stability, external pressure, financial targets, nature of the industry, ineffective supervision, external auditor quality, auditor turnover, director turnover, arrogance, and state-owned enterprises) on financial statement fraud.
